Frequently Asked Questions about Flagler Beach

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Flagler Beach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Flagler Beach ranges from $899 to $3,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,632.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Flagler Beach c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Flagler Beach range from $999 to $7,329.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,822.

How expensive are Flagler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 36 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Flagler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,184 to $4,400 - averaging $2,239 for the location.
